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| banded carpet shell | Pichincha Thomasomys |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Mollusca (Mollusks)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Bivalvia (Bivalvia)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Venerida (Venerida)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Veneridae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Polititapes | Thomasomys |
| Species | Polititapes rhomboides | Thomasomys vulcani |
